Planning and Purchasing Furniture
Measure Twice, Buy Once: Ever tried to fit a square peg in a round hole? That’s moving a couch into an apartment without measuring. Arm yourself with a tape measure to avoid such a fate.
Picking the Right Retailer: Not all heroes wear capes, and not all furniture stores excel in apartment deliveries. Look for ones that understand the high-rise hustle.
Deciphering Delivery Policies: It’s like reading the fine print on a treasure map. Know what you’re signing up for—whether it’s leaving your new loveseat at the door or a full white-glove service to your living room.
Preparing for Delivery
Timing is Everything: Synchronize your delivery with a time you can be home. Aligning the planets might be easier, but it’s worth a shot.
Day-of Prep Work: Clear a path as if you’re expecting royalty. Move anything that could turn your delivery into an obstacle course.
Navigating Apartment Complex Challenges
Stairs vs. Elevator: Brief the delivery team on what they’re up against. If your building has an elevator, make friends with it (and maybe reserve it, too).
A Chat with the Building Manager: Sometimes, the building manager is the gatekeeper to your delivery success. A quick chat can ensure no rules are bent or broken during the operation.
Tight Squeezes and Parking Woes: If your apartment was designed by someone who hates furniture, you might have some tight spots. Give the delivery folks a heads-up. And remember, parking can be a beast—plan accordingly.
Receiving Your Furniture
The Moment of Truth: Inspect your new piece as if you were buying a diamond. Look for any damage before signing off.
To Assemble or Not to Assemble: Some see furniture assembly as a puzzle; others see it as a nightmare. Know which camp you’re in before diving in.
When Things Go South: If the sofa’s leg is missing or it won’t fit through the door, don’t panic. Document everything and get in touch with the seller post-haste.
Additional Tips
Packaging Be Gone: Your new furniture is here, but now you’re drowning in cardboard. Recycling or creative repurposing can turn that tide.
Good Neighbor Vibes: Sharing your delivery plans with neighbors isn’t just courteous—it can prevent side-eyes in the elevator later.
